Sony vcr model:SLV-M77,year:Aug 1989,has a Sanyo mechanics chassis:
http://www.studiosoundelectronics.com/mbk-31.htm and the problem is that during playback of a recorded tape on that machine the audio is intermittent but playback of rental tapes or tapes recorded on other machines is fine.I noticed that the famous SCA3.0 cam belt was bad so I replaced it (it was obviously stretched and would not allow both tape guide posts fully forward so the film was not at the right height on the audio control head),cleaned the vcr and cleaned/lubed the capstan motor so the vcr worked great for 1 month and now customer calls back and says problem is back.
